Last night, Mackenzi and I attended Yelp’s Spring Spectacle event, which was held at the Museum of Moving Image. Really just an excuse to get together and celebrate spring, the event was a lot of fun, as it combined great music, food, drinks and the fabulous members of our community all under one roof. The venue was just spectacular and in addition to enjoying some of the best eats and drinks of the borough, attendees also had the pleasure of roaming around the museum and getting a look at MOMI’s latest exhibit, Spectacle. One of the most popular areas was the LUMI8 photo booth, which people had a lot of fun with. Tons of playful accessories such as hats, glasses, mustaches, etc were provided to spruce up the photos.
Taverna Kyclades went simple yet elegant with these feta, olive and tomato skewers.
Rudy’s Pastry Shop of Ridgewood went all out with their dark chocolate, caramel pretzel mini cupcakes.
My ultimate favorite of the night were JoJu’s banh mis which came out piping hot and a little crunchy too. I had to go back for seconds – it wasn’t an option not to.
Takesushi of Sunnyside absolutely killed it with their made-to-order hand rolls. It was the hottest ticket at the event aside from the photo booth.
